Yes, this rings true, it took me over a month to actually get to at least 1x of my usual productivity with Claude Code. There is a ton of setup and ton of things to learn and try to see what works. What to watch out for and how to babysit it so it doesn't go off the rails (quite heavy handed approach works best for me). It's kind of like a shitty, but very fast and very knowledgable junior developer. At this moment it still maybe isn't "worth it" for a lot of devs if productivity (and developer ergonomics) is the only goal, but it is clear to me that this is where the industry is heading and I think every dev will eventually have to get on board. These tools really just started to be somewhat decent this year. I'm 100% sure that in a year or two it will be the default for everyone in a way that you simply won't be able to compete without it at all. It would be like using a shovel instead of an excavator. Remember, right now is the worst it'll ever be.

Casual embezzling on all levels of society was extremely common in communist Czechoslovakia (and probably other Eastern Bloc countries). For example construction workers might steal material from their job site to build their own house (often during work hours as well). There was even a popular adage normalizing this behaviour: "One who doesn't steal steals from his own family".
